Rollie O. Smith, 82, of Cisne, IL died April 8, 2006, at Fairfield Memorial Hospital.

Mr. Smith was born May 21, 1923 in Cisne, the son of Fred Monroe and Gracie A. Bunnell Smith. He married Ruth States February 25, 1945 in Cisne.

He was a member and deacon of Blue Point Free Will Baptist church in Cisne and a member of Mt. Erie Ruritan Club.

He was a farmer and worked at Valley Steel in Flora. After retirement he continued occasional farming projects for Mugrage Farms in Cisne. He enjoyed life by serving in his church, helping others, and working in the community.

Survivors include his wife of 61 years; a daughter, Pamela Courtright; a twin brother Robert Smith; two gr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ews.

Preceding him in death were his parents, a son, Bill; four brothers; and one foster sister.

Funeral services were held at Hosselton Funeral Home with burial in the Cisne Cemetery.
